ICE brokers detained greater than 100 illegals throughout an immigration raid at a Tallahassee, Florida, development website on Thursday.
“U.S. Immigrations and Customs Enforcement’s Homeland Safety Investigation served a number of search warrants as a part of an ongoing investigation within the Tallahassee area,” ICE mentioned in a press release to native media.
Among the illegals fled earlier than ICE brokers have been capable of detain them.
“The unlawful aliens are from Mexico, Guatemala, Nicaragua, El Salvador, Colombia & Honduras, to call a couple of,” Homeland Safety Investigations Tampa mentioned on X.

The Tallahassee Democrat reported:
Homeland Safety Investigations (which is underneath ICE), together with the Florida Freeway Patrol and different Florida and federal legislation enforcement businesses, conducted immigration raids on Thursday, Might 29 in Tallahassee.
Greater than 100 individuals have been detained at a student housing development construction site described as “a short walk from Doak Campbell Stadium” within the CollegeTown space.
Officers reportedly checked each particular person’s identification and permits earlier than releasing or detaining them.
A employee from a close-by constructing website mentioned his development website had been raided an hour earlier, with individuals fleeing and a few caught.
The unlawful aliens have been rounded up at a development website close to Florida State College’s campus.
